| 69 |
|
|
| 70 |
} // プロキシの設定 |
} // プロキシの設定 |
| 71 |
|
|
| 72 |
|
// ウインドウの位置 |
| 73 |
var stageX: Number = 0; |
var stageX: Number = 0; |
| 74 |
var stageY: Number = 0; |
var stageY: Number = 0; |
| 75 |
|
|
| 82 |
stageY = Number.valueOf(config.get("y")); |
stageY = Number.valueOf(config.get("y")); |
| 83 |
} |
} |
| 84 |
|
|
|
|
|
| 85 |
var alpha: Number = 0; |
var alpha: Number = 0; |
| 86 |
def ConunterToPreference: Timeline = Timeline { |
def ConunterToPreference: Timeline = Timeline { |
| 87 |
keyFrames : [ |
keyFrames : [ |
| 137 |
|
|
| 138 |
onStart: function(title: String, start: Long){ |
onStart: function(title: String, start: Long){ |
| 139 |
|
|
| 140 |
if(counter.isTwitter){ |
if(counter.isTwitter and preference.startTweet.length() != 0){ |
|
|
|
|
if(preference.startTweet.length() != 0){ |
|
|
|
|
|
SendTweet{ |
|
|
status: preference.startTweet.replace("\{title\}", "{title}") |
|
|
}.start(); |
|
| 141 |
|
|
| 142 |
} |
SendTweet.send(preference.startTweet.replace("\{title\}", "{title}")); |
| 143 |
|
|
| 144 |
} |
} |
| 145 |
|
|
| 147 |
|
|
| 148 |
onStop: function(title: String, start: Long, end: Long){ |
onStop: function(title: String, start: Long, end: Long){ |
| 149 |
|
|
| 150 |
if(counter.isTwitter){ |
if(counter.isTwitter and preference.endTweet.length() != 0){ |
| 151 |
|
|
| 152 |
if(preference.endTweet.length() != 0){ |
SendTweet.send(preference.endTweet.replace("\{title\}", "{title}")); |
|
|
|
|
SendTweet{ |
|
|
status: preference.endTweet.replace("\{title\}", "{title}") |
|
|
}.start(); |
|
|
|
|
|
} |
|
| 153 |
|
|
| 154 |
} |
} |
| 155 |
|
|
| 172 |
|
|
| 173 |
def preference: Preference = Preference{ // 設定画面 |
def preference: Preference = Preference{ // 設定画面 |
| 174 |
|
|
| 175 |
|
// 各項目を初期化する |
| 176 |
startTweet: config.get("Twitter.StartTweet") |
startTweet: config.get("Twitter.StartTweet") |
| 177 |
endTweet: config.get("Twitter.EndTweet") |
endTweet: config.get("Twitter.EndTweet") |
| 178 |
googleID: config.get("GoogleCalendar.ID") |
googleID: config.get("GoogleCalendar.ID") |
| 183 |
translateX: 5 |
translateX: 5 |
| 184 |
translateY: 5 |
translateY: 5 |
| 185 |
|
|
| 186 |
|
// 始め設定画面は無効にしておく |
| 187 |
|
disable: true |
| 188 |
|
|
| 189 |
onOK : function(){ |
onOK : function(){ |
| 190 |
config.put("Twitter.startTweet", preference.startTweet); |
config.put("Twitter.startTweet", preference.startTweet); |
| 191 |
config.put("Twitter.endTweet", preference.startTweet); |
config.put("Twitter.endTweet", preference.startTweet); |